Uttar Pradesh Braces for Prolonged Cold Spell as Temperatures Plummet

As of November 9th, 2025, Uttar Pradesh is in the grip of a prolonged cold spell, with temperatures across the state falling sharply and no significant change expected in the coming week.

The recent weather patterns, including a western disturbance and cold, dry winds from the snow-covered western Himalayas, have led to a significant drop in both maximum and minimum temperatures. Several cities in Uttar Pradesh have recorded minimum temperatures well below the seasonal average, with Etawah seeing the lowest temperature of the season at 8.4°C, around 6.3°C below normal.

Other cities have also experienced a chill, with Kanpur, Bulandshahr, Bareilly, and Prayagraj all registering minimum temperatures 4 to 6 degrees Celsius below average. In the state capital of Lucknow, the minimum temperature was 13.6°C, while the maximum settled at 28.1°C, both lower than usual.

According to the Lucknow Meteorological Office, the cold spell is expected to continue for at least the next week, with minimum temperatures likely to remain 2 to 4°C below normal and maximum temperatures 1 to 3°C below average. As a result, residents of Lucknow and other parts of Uttar Pradesh have been seen bundling up in warm clothing to brave the chilly winds and low temperatures.
